With rapid urbanization transforming our world, Big 5 Global convenes 1,500 key industry leaders in Dubai from November 26-29 to explore vital solutions for the challenges facing global cities.[?]
Source: Big 5 Global
Along with co-located events LiveableCitiesX, GeoWorld, and Future FM, Big 5 Global will host five strategic summits dedicated to innovative construction practices, sustainability, and the development of thriving urban spaces.[?] [?] [?]
With cities in the Global South grappling with overcrowding and resource management, and the Global North facing aging infrastructure and demographic shifts, global cooperation is essential. Big 5 Global, together with LiveableCitiesX, serves as the epicenter of innovation, gathering visionaries, policymakers, and industry experts to shape the urban communities of tomorrow.

With $6.75 trillion worth of urban projects planned in the Middle East, Africa, and South Asia (MEASA) region, the UAE is taking a leading role in sustainable construction through initiatives like UAE Vision 2031.[?] To further these efforts, the Big 5 Global Leaders’ Summit and the LiveableCitiesX Summit will convene government and private sector leaders to discuss the future of urban development, focusing on innovation and sustainable infrastructure.

By 2080, 80% of the world's population is expected to live in cities.[?] These summits will bring together governments and businesses to talk about sustainable growth, building better infrastructure, and creating communities that can withstand challenges. The discussions will support both national goals and international sustainability efforts.
